Position Summary:

The Aviation Department is housed at the Aviation Technology Center of Excellence located just west of Tucson International Airport. The #1 goal of Aviation faculty and staff is to provide world-class service and training to our diverse student body. We currently offer training for aspiring Airframe and Powerplant Mechanics, Avionics Technicians, Structural Repair Technicians, and Nondestructive Testing Technicians; and have plans to expand program offerings in the areas Unmanned Aircraft Systems, and Professional Pilot Training.

The Aviation Program Assistant position is for a full-time non-exempt staff member beginning summer 2023. The individual filling this position is responsible for a variety of office support duties for multiple programs of study within the Aviation Technology program. They will perform a full range of advanced clerical and office support duties to include, but not limited to, managing student enrollment; providing information and assistance to the college and the public; creating presentations in multiple formats; generating reports, requisitions, purchase orders, and monitoring invoices; updating and managing department files and records; schedules department meetings; proctoring industry certification exams for students and the public.

The work schedule for this position is flexible and may include working evenings and will possibly work at more than one campus, depending on need.
